OnePlus 5T's Face Unlock could arrive on OnePlus 5 with Android 8.0 beta

OnePlus stated that the Face Unlock feature from the 5T wouldn't be arriving on the OnePlus 5. But, a leaked Android 8.0 beta for the phone shows the feature and it has been confirmed to be working.

Despite the OnePlus team stating that the OnePlus 5 would not be getting the 5T's face unlock feature, digging into a leaked build of Android 8.0 Oreo for the handset, reveals that the feature could indeed arrive at some point.

If unfamiliar, Face Unlock is a new feature that debuted on the recently released OnePlus 5T that allows a user to unlock their handset instantly by using their face. While this similar feature has been available on other handsets, the one found on the OnePlus is surprisingly fast. Although it might not be as secure as what's found on Apple's iPhone X, it is still quite impressive and being praised by reviewers and consumers alike.

The folks over at XDA Developers have confirmed that the feature is indeed working on the OnePlus 5 and now all there is to do is wait for the official release of the beta to see whether it will make an appearance. The beta of Android 8.0 Oreo is set to make its way to the handset starting next week, so luckily there isn't much longer to wait.
